New Vance City is a post-collapse RPG where survival means customizing everything—classes, skills, races, and gear are all unique. Set in 2070, a year after the world cracked and the infected rose, this cyberpunk dystopia pulses with story-rich factions, brutal politics, and unforgettable characters. Forge your path in a smog-choked ruin where the line between savior and syndicate blurs with every shot fired. Fight zombies, raiders, and mutated creatures and test your survival in New Vance City!


Author's Note: The year is 2070, one year after the Collapse. The place? New Vance City. Skeletal remains of skyscrapers pierce the smog-choked sky. Patches of overgrown desert flora claw at cracked asphalt. Inside, survivors try to make the best of their fragile existence, repurposing solar panels and scavenging for supplies. Kids growing up in this hell hole play amongst the ruins of the city, their laughter a thin, hopeful melody that just isn't strong enough to pierce through the grim ambiance of the city. Life here is filled with nothing but scarcity and fear. Every creak in the night, every flicker in the solar grid, every hum or buzz... It's all enough to send shivers down your spines. Patrols, armed with anything from repurposed energy weapons to hastily thrown together pipe rifles scan the horizon for "shamblers," the remnants of the infected. Yet amidst the hardship, the community is still blooming. New Vance City still stands, at least for now. A flickering candle in the encroaching darkness of a world forever changed.

The Shambler’s Graveyard
The Shambler’s Graveyard
Area
Details
Size0
TypeHaunted Urban Ruins
Description

Once a dense residential sprawl, the Shambler’s Graveyard is now a suffocating maze of decay and silence. Roofs have caved in under the weight of mold and memories. Every room is a nest, every street a slow-motion nightmare. Shamblers roam without purpose—but not without patterns. Something guides them. The Silent Walkers. Draped in patchwork rags and bone-laced garb, these eerie figures drift through the infected like priests among parishioners. They are not attacked. They do not speak. They take things—trinkets, tech, even bodies—and vanish into the mist. Some believe they’ve merged with the infection, others think they command it. No other faction enters. No patrols sweep here. It's not worth the risk of coming back… wrong. The Graveyard isn’t a battlefield—it’s a slow, rotting surrender. A place where the line between human and horror quietly dissolves, and the living must ask: how long can you walk among the dead before you become one of them?

Appearance

The Graveyard is a drowned suburbia choked in fungal bloom and gray mist. Cracked windows ooze bio-sludge, and Shambler silhouettes drift through doorframes like broken metronomes. Streetlights flicker in sync with unseen pulses, while Silent Walkers glide soundlessly through the fog, their pale faces unreadable and their robes trailing mold and sorrow.
